RANDOM, Wis. (CBS 58) -- The Random Lake Fire Department will be hosting its annual picnic with food, music and fun on Sunday, July 30. It also includes a parade which starts at 12:00 p.m.
This year, the Fire Department will be having a special display in the parade, bringing awareness to the need for organ donations.
Jean Mueller, whose husband was an organ donor says, "If one more person signs up, that's a big thing because, like I said, take 75 people are affected by one donor and it can change somebody's life completely."
Attendees of the parade and picnic will have the chance to sign up to be an organ donor.
